We are looking for an ITIL Service Architect for a 12 Months contract based in Bristol (3 days per week in the office) on behalf of our globally respected client who develop cutting-edge technologies that deliver clean, safe and competitive solutions to meet the planet's vital power needs.

Purpose of the Role:

As ITIL Service Architect you will work with principal stakeholders across the business, design and build operational and service management capability designing services to support critical business functions and services.

As an ITIL Service Architect you will be responsible for:

  • Working with the Service and Operate capability to collaboratively define and oversee the design of services with principal stakeholders.
  • Working closely with individual suppliers and a Matrix supply chain to define services in accordance with business service owners' current service and operational portfolio.
  • Planning and scheduling workload against a defined and agreed sequence of activity bringing Facilities, Infrastructure and Applications under a support capability, which is overseen, governed and enforced by security controls and standards.
  • Stakeholder management skills from programme to C-suite.
  • Supporting the wider project team with service management and service operation queries.
  • Developing services that can be signed off by the business and support a centralised service and operational capability.

What we require from the candidate:

  • Experience working on IT projects in the Defence sector.
  • Experience in system integration.
  • An excellent understanding of commonly used concepts, practices and procedures within service and operational support.
  • SC cleared are preferable.
  • Must be flexible and adaptable in their approach to delivery of individual and programme objectives.
  • Ability to work at pace and perform tasks simultaneously.
